Why a Friendly Smile Matters

Imagine walking into a store after a long day, ready to grab your essentials. You approach the till, and the cashier greets you with a friendly smile. Instantly, you feel a bit lighter, right? This warm welcome is no accident; it’s a vital element in creating a positive atmosphere. Studies show that a friendly demeanor can unravel the tensions of a hectic shopping day. When cashiers engage customers with genuine warmth, it sets the tone for the entire interaction—to feel valued and appreciated.

So, why does this matter? When a cashier provides prompt and friendly service, customers are more likely to return. It cultivates loyalty—a precious commodity in today’s competitive retail landscape.

The Power of Listening

Let’s pause for a moment (literally). Imagine you’ve got a question about a product, perhaps a special ingredient you’re unsure of. You ask the cashier, but they respond with a halfhearted answer while looking at the register. Frustrating, right? A little listening can go a long way.

Being an attentive ear can enhance customer interactions immensely. Customers want to feel heard. When a cashier actively listens, it shows that they care about the customer's needs. A simple—“I’ll help you find that!”—can transform what could be a mundane exchange into a delightful experience. Moreover, satisfied customers become brand advocates, telling their friends about the exceptional service they received.

Efficiency Speaks Volumes

Let’s not forget about efficiency. There’s an art to being prompt without seeming rushed, like perfectly mastering that tricky recipe your grandmother made. Not only does quick service ease the flow of customers, they appreciate someone who respects their time.

Imagine a busy Friday afternoon; the line is long, and everyone’s trying to finish their shopping before the weekend festivities kick in. A cashier who can efficiently scan items and handle transactions while still making small talk is a game-changer. This balance ensures that customers feel valued without the impatience of waiting too long, yielding not just satisfaction but also repeat business.

The Cost of Indifference

Now, let’s entertain a contrasting scenario. What happens when cashiers adopt an indifferent attitude? A quick roll of the eyes or a lackluster “next, please” can sour the customer experience faster than you can say “return policy.” Indifference can instantly make customers feel unwanted. It’s unsettling and can leave a lasting negative impression, pushing customers to shop elsewhere.

Think about it—you’ve likely felt this way at some point. We remember the stores that made us feel unimportant because of one indifferent encounter. In a world so connected, negative experiences travel fast; the word spreads, and suddenly, a store known for excellent products finds itself battling a tarnished reputation.

Building a Loyal Customer Base

Now, let’s land on the golden nugget here—creating a loyal customer base. It’s not just about ringing up purchases; it's about fostering relationships. Repeat customers are often the bread and butter of retail. They not only come back but also spread the word about their experiences, whether good or bad.

Think about if a cashier recognized that you always buy the same brand of tea. A simple comment like, “I see you’re back for your favorite blend!” weaves a sense of community and belonging. This attention to detail proves that cashiers aren’t just operators of cash registers but are integral to the overall customer journey.
